  • The Arora Group is currently recruiting a Physician - Occupational Medicine and Urgent Care in Washington, DC., to support the Department of Homeland Security Headquarters Workforce Care Clinic at the St. Elizabeth's Campus. The Physician will provide occupational medicine, urgent care, and mission-related clinical services supporting the health, medical readiness, and continuity of operations of the DHS workforce and other authorized patient populations.

    This is a full-time, onsite position, generally scheduled Monday through Friday from 8:00 a.m. to 4:30 p.m. Eastern Time. The position is contingent upon contract award and is anticipated to begin September 22, 2026. The anticipated contract term is up to five years.
